The President of the Ghana National Association of Farmers and Fishermen (GNAFF), Nai Kwao Otuo V, has said elections are about choosing a group of competent people to administer the country and not about life and death.
"There is therefore the need to maintain a peaceful election so that Ghanaians can carry on with their lives".
Nai Otuo said this in a statement at the 24th National Farmers Day Celebration jointly organised by the Effutu Municipal and Awutu-Senya district Assembly at Awutu Beraku.
He appealed to farmers and fishers to ensure that they vote wisely and peacefully during the December election to maintain peace before, during and after the election.
Nai Otuo congratulated farmers and fishers in the country for their efforts to ensure the progress of Ghana's agriculture in the face of daunting challenges in the sector.
He said the association would continue to enhance its role of directly supporting farmers and fishers in attaining increased productivity and profitability in the coming years.
